airBaltic announces a unique Behind the Scenes Technical Department event on April 25, 2024 in its technical facilities in Riga—an unprecedented opportunity for professionals across various technical fields to explore the aviation industry from the inside and for those considering new career opportunities. This initiative is designed to attract individuals from diverse technical backgrounds, including civil engineering, transportation, vehicle mechanics, and more, offering them a unique glimpse into the airline's daily operations in its modern hangar and encouraging them to consider joining the airBaltic team.

Alīna Aronberga, Senior Vice President Human Resources at airBaltic commented: “As airBaltic continues to grow, we are delighted to announce our upcoming Behind the Scenes Technical Department event at airBaltic. For the first time, we are offering this unique opportunity for individuals from diverse technical fields and students who are exploring future career path to experience a day in the life at the airlines technical department in our impressive Concors Hangar. We have prepared an exciting program and eagerly anticipate welcoming everyone who is interested to come under our wing.”

The open day at airBaltic is scheduled for April 25, 2024, starting at 17:00 at the airBaltic technical facilities in Riga, Latvia (Tehnikas Street 3, Marupe County, Riga district). This year, airBaltic plans to hire more than 100 professionals in 40 positions within its Technical department. 

airBaltic currently employs more than 2 500 professionals and is actively recruiting for various positions. The airline currently offers 33 open positions to attract over 150 new talents. For several years, airBaltic has been consistently recognized as the Top Employer in various nationwide and worldwide surveys.
